Who is Lloyds Banking Group and where does this role sit?

 

Lloyds Banking Group is on the mission to build the bank of the future, and we need help to do it. Continuing our extensive transformation programme, we're redefining what a bank needs to be

 

From the inside out. Our technology, our culture, and our mind-set is changing, all to show what an engineering-led organisation can do. This vacancy is in the Commercial Banking division, within the Origination value stream. Our purpose is to create and deliver products that enable clients to grow their businesses. Those businesses provide services that millions of customers across the UK rely upon, day-to-day and especially in their time of need.

 

We're seeking to recruit a strong Lead SRE/Platform Engineer to support our journey onto the Azure Public Cloud Platform. This is a key time in our journey, and we're seeking people who will enjoy the opportunity to shape the direction and success of our new team.

 

What will you spend your time doing?

You'll work in a hybrid role which combines Site Reliability, Platform and Systems engineering, to build and run large-scale, distributed, fault-tolerant systems. The diversity, intellectual curiosity, continual learning, problem solving and openness to learning are key to its success.

 

Our Engineers are passionate about ensuring the services, both internal and external have extreme reliability, uptime appropriate to users' needs, resiliency, architectural simplicity, as well as continually seeking to find improvements.

You'll have the opportunity to deal with complex challenges, while using your expertise in coding, algorithms, complexity/forensic analysis and various system design strategies to tackle those challenges.

 

Much of your focus will be on optimising existing systems on Azure, building new Azure PaaS and IaaS solutions for services currently not running on Azure and eliminating manual work through automation wherever feasible. A further stage will be to apply those skills to GCP.

 

You'll work with people from a wide variety of backgrounds, experiences and perspectives. We encourage collaboration and mentoring people in DevOps methodologies that are supported by solid engineering practices. Self-direction is important, and we strive to create an environment that supports this through trust, learning, and mentorship.

This would be a great role if you;

Are working as a senior engineer and looking to take the next step.

Are a person who enjoys a hybrid role involving solution design, architecture considerations while still coding hands on 60-80% of the time.

Are interested in the opportunity to influence the commercial direction of our public cloud offering.

Enjoy working in a dynamic team who encourage experimentation and exploration of different technical solutions.

 

As a minimum to be considered, we would need to see evidence of;

Prior work experience at a senior engineering level within the field of DevOps.

Very strong DevOps skills with expertise in integration tools like Jenkins, Azure DevOps, Nexus, and Git

Kubernetes & Istio (AKS an advantage)

Experience programming in at least two (but not all!) of the following languages: Java, Groovy, Scala, Python, Go, C++, JavaScript, PowerShell or Bash/Shell

Systematic problem-solving approach, comfortable gathering requirements and strong

Communication skills and a sense of ownership

Knowledge of effective cloud architecture solutions.
